As part of efforts to strengthen institutional collaboration and promote data protection and privacy, the Nigeria Data Protection Commission (NDPC) has formalised a partnership with Nasarawa State University, Keffi (NSUK) through a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U).
The National Commissioner/CEO of the NDPC, Dr Vincent Olatunji, received the Vice-Chancellor of Nasarawa State University, Keffi (NSUK), Professor Sa’adatu Hassan Liman, and other university officials for the signing of the MoU.
The Vice-Chancellor, who signed on behalf of the University, commended Dr Olatunji for the warm reception and noted that the MoU builds on the existing relationship between NDPC and NSUK. She reaffirmed the University’s commitment to serving as a pacesetter among tertiary institutions and to advancing data protection and privacy in Nigeria.
In his remarks, Dr Olatunji commended the management of NSUK, led by Professor Liman, for its proactive approach to data protection and privacy as a means of strengthening privacy culture and compliance within the University and the State at large. He noted that the MoU would further deepen the partnership, particularly in the areas of human capital development and awareness creation within the University.
